Zilliqa and Cardano: A Deep Dive into Blockchain Scalability and Sustainability

5 min read
Moso Panda
Moso Panda
Crypto Connoisseur
Zilliqa vs Cardano comparison
Zilliqa
Cardano

The blockchain arena is bustling with innovative platforms vying to solve long-standing issues of scalability, security, and sustainability. Zilliqa and Cardano stand out as two distinct contenders, each bringing unique architectures and philosophies to the table. While Zilliqa pioneered sharding technology to achieve linear scalability, Cardano emphasizes a layered, eco-friendly approach with formal verification. This blog aims to dissect their underlying technologies, use cases, and future prospects, providing crypto enthusiasts and investors with a comprehensive, technical comparison.

Understanding Zilliqa and Cardano ?

Zilliqa, launched in 2017, was the first blockchain to implement sharding, a technique that divides the network into smaller pieces called shards to process transactions in parallel. This approach significantly boosts throughput, making Zilliqa suitable for high-frequency applications. Its native smart contract language, Scilla, prioritizes security and formal verification, reducing vulnerabilities common in traditional smart contract platforms.

Cardano, also launched in 2017, was developed with a focus on scientific philosophy and peer-reviewed research. Its layered architecture separates the settlement and computation layers, enhancing flexibility and upgradeability. Utilizing Ouroboros, a provably secure proof-of-stake protocol, Cardano emphasizes sustainability, scalability, and formal methods to ensure robust security and decentralization.

Both platforms aim to address scalability and security but approach these goals differently. Zilliqa's sharding allows linear scalability, making it highly efficient for transaction-heavy dApps. Conversely, Cardano’s layered design and formal verification aim to provide a more flexible and secure environment for a broad range of decentralized applications, including enterprise solutions.

As the blockchain ecosystem evolves, both platforms are implementing upgrades. Zilliqa is integrating Ethereum Virtual Machine (EVM) compatibility to support Solidity-based dApps, while Cardano is expanding its ecosystem with sidechains and native token support, reinforcing its commitment to scalability and interoperability.

Key Differences Between Zilliqa and Cardano

Consensus Mechanism

  • Zilliqa: Zilliqa employs Practical Byzantine Fault Tolerance (pBFT) combined with proof-of-work to secure its sharded network, ensuring instant finality and high throughput. Its consensus mechanism is optimized for scalability and security in a decentralized environment.
  • Cardano: Cardano utilizes Ouroboros, a proof-of-stake protocol based on formal proofs, which offers energy efficiency and security. Its consensus mechanism is designed for sustainability and high decentralization, handling thousands of transactions per second with minimal energy consumption.

Architecture Design

  • Zilliqa: Zilliqa is the world's first sharded blockchain, with a two-layer structure involving the Directory Service (DS) and Transaction (TX) layers, enabling linear scalability as the network grows. Its architecture emphasizes high throughput and low latency for transactions and smart contracts.
  • Cardano: Cardano’s architecture features a layered design with separate settlement and computation layers. This separation facilitates easy upgrades, enhanced security, and flexibility, supporting complex smart contracts and dApps across multiple industries.

Smart Contract Languages

  • Zilliqa: Zilliqa uses Scilla, a secure-by-design, peer-reviewed smart contract language that supports formal verification, reducing vulnerabilities and improving security in smart contract development.
  • Cardano: Cardano supports smart contracts written in Plutus (Haskell-based) and IELE, providing developers with high-level languages that prioritize security and formal methods, ensuring reliable and tamper-proof applications.

Scalability Approach

  • Zilliqa: Zilliqa’s sharding allows the network to scale linearly with increased nodes, supporting thousands of transactions per second, ideal for high-throughput applications like finance and gaming.
  • Cardano: Cardano’s scalability is achieved through layered architecture, sidechains, and parallel processing, aiming for high throughput while maintaining security and decentralization, suitable for enterprise-grade applications.

Use of Native Assets

  • Zilliqa: Zilliqa’s ZIL token powers transactions, smart contract execution, and incentivizes miners. Its low gas fees make microtransactions feasible, fostering innovative dApps.
  • Cardano: Cardano’s ADA token is used for staking, transactions, and governance. Its eco-friendly proof-of-stake system emphasizes sustainability, appealing to environmentally conscious users and institutions.

Zilliqa vs Cardano Comparison

FeatureZilliqaCardano
Consensus AlgorithmpBFT + proof-of-work for scalability and securityOuroboros proof-of-stake for efficiency & security
Architectural DesignSharded, two-layer (DS and TX layers)Layered (Settlement and Computation layers)
Smart Contract LanguagesScilla (formal verification focused)Plutus and IELE (high-level, secure)
Scalability MethodLinear scalability via shardingLayered architecture and sidechains
Native AssetZIL, low gas fees, micro-paymentsADA, eco-friendly, staking rewards

Ideal For

Choose Zilliqa: Zilliqa is ideal for developers and businesses requiring high throughput, microtransactions, and scalable smart contracts, especially in finance, gaming, and real-time data processing.

Choose Cardano: Cardano is suited for enterprise solutions, institutions, and developers seeking a secure, sustainable platform with formal verification, supporting complex dApps and scalable DeFi applications.

Conclusion: Zilliqa vs Cardano

Zilliqa and Cardano exemplify two distinct philosophies in blockchain development—one prioritizing raw scalability through sharding, and the other emphasizing formal security and layered flexibility. Zilliqa’s innovative sharding architecture provides unparalleled transaction throughput, making it an excellent choice for high-frequency applications. On the other hand, Cardano’s layered design and rigorous scientific approach offer a highly secure, adaptable platform with long-term sustainability in mind.

Ultimately, the choice between Zilliqa and Cardano hinges on specific project needs: whether prioritizing speed and microtransactions or security and flexibility. For developers aiming to build high-performance dApps, Zilliqa offers a compelling, scalable environment. Conversely, institutions and enterprise developers seeking a formal, upgradeable blockchain might find Cardano’s architecture more aligned with their goals. Both platforms are poised to influence the future landscape of blockchain technology, each excelling in different domains.

Want More Ways To Earn Crypto? Download the Moso Extension Today!

Related Articles